2023 Jeep Wrangler Reviews Summary

The Jeep Wrangler’s roots go all the way back to World War II when the Willys-Overland company supplied the MB to the American troops. Fast forward some 60 years or so and we have the iconic Jeep Wrangler JL, one of the last body-on-frame SUVs left for folks who prioritize off-road capability over creature comforts.

Every Wrangler comes with solid front and rear axles and a five-link suspension system. However, some popular trim levels like the Sport, High Altitude, Willys Sport, and Sahara don’t get locking differentials or meaty tires, so choose your Wrangler carefully.

2024 Lexus GX Reviews Summary

Redesigning a long-running vehicle requires a big swing, and after fourteen years since the second-generation model debuted, building the all-new 2024 GX was a tall order. Lexus’s engineers struck out to make this midsize SUV better in every way: better tech, a better engine, more capability, and more luxury. They succeeded.

Verdict: Comfortable but rugged, the thirsty, body-on-frame Lexus GX isn’t the right luxury SUV for every shopper. However, for those in the market for this particular blend of lavish capability, it may be the best option on the market.

Look and feel

2023 Jeep Wrangler

9/10

2024 Lexus GX

8/10

The 2023 Jeep Wrangler offered a rugged, take-no-prisoners design aesthetic with straight lines and an angular silhouette, hearkening back to its military origins. Available in both two-door and four-door configurations, the Wrangler could be further customized by removing the doors and even the windshield, adding to its adventurous appeal. Wide fenders emblazoned with the American flag, Jeep’s iconic seven-slot grille, and old-school hood latches contributed to its distinct, classic look.

On the other hand, the 2024 Lexus GX presented a dramatic shift from its former design. The new model adopted a geometric styling approach, giving it a more aggressive look. The signature “spindle” grille became less pronounced, flanked by standard triple-beam LED headlights. The front fascia stood taller and more vertical, providing a confident stance. The flat hood rose along the sides, aiding in off-road positional awareness. Character lines were minimal, maintaining a horizontal path, while the window beltline sat lower to improve visibility. The GX’s aesthetic aimed for both sophistication and ruggedness, capturing a balance that appealed to those seeking luxury with a hint of adventure.

Performance

2023 Jeep Wrangler

9/10

2024 Lexus GX

9/10

The 2023 Jeep Wrangler was tailor-made for off-road enthusiasts, with multiple powertrain options catering to diverse preferences. The base models offered a 3.6-liter V6 engine providing 285 horsepower and 260 pound-feet of torque, alongside a 2.0-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ine with 270 horsepower and 295 pound-feet of torque. Both engines could be paired with either an eight-speed automatic or a six-speed manual transmission. Eco-conscious drivers could opt for the 4xe plug-in hybrid with 21 miles of all-electric range.

The standout performer was the Wrangler Rubicon 392, equipped with a 6.4-liter V8 engine, delivering a thrilling 470 horsepower and 470 pound-feet of torque. This model excelled in off-road environments, boasting a crawl ratio of 58:1 with the Xtreme Recon package, perfect for tackling challenging terrain. However, its on-road performance suffered due to inadequate braking capacity and vague steering.

Conversely, the 2024 Lexus GX introduced a robust 3.4-liter twin-turbocharged V6 engine, producing 349 horsepower and 479 pound-feet of torque. This represented a significant improvement over its predecessor’s naturally aspirated V8. Built on the new GA-F truck platform, the GX felt more stable both on-road and off-road. The 10-speed automatic transmission operated smoothly, and standard full-time 4WD, along with a locking Torsen limited-slip center differential, ensured excellent traction.

The GX’s Overtrail trims included a rear locking differential and the innovative Electronic Kinetic Dynamic Suspension System (E-KDSS), enhancing wheel articulation and stability. Our test revealed strong acceleration and reliable brakes, though we noted the suspension's capability only under moderate off-road conditions.

Form and function

2023 Jeep Wrangler

8/10

2024 Lexus GX

7/10

The 2023 Jeep Wrangler provided a practical yet utilitarian interior. The front seats were comfortable, especially in the 392 model, though ventilated seats were not available. The rear seats in the four-door models were tight and entering the rear could be cumbersome due to the small doors. Cargo space was somewhat limited, with 72.4 cubic feet available with the rear seats folded. This was slightly bested by the Bronco but still sufficient for most adventures.

The Wrangler’s various roof configurations, including an optional Sky One-Touch power soft top, allowed for versatile open-air experiences. The interior also featured multiple USB ports and a 115-volt outlet for convenient charging.

The 2024 Lexus GX elevated interior comfort and space. With 41.2 inches of legroom in the front and 36.7 inches in the second row, it offered ample room for adult passengers. The optional third row was best suited for children, given its limited legroom. Cargo capacity was a strong point, providing 76.9 cubic feet with all seats folded down. Overtrail models increased this to 90.5 cubic feet, making it the cargo-space king among luxury SUVs.

Technology

2023 Jeep Wrangler

8/10

2024 Lexus GX

7/10

The 2023 Jeep Wrangler came with a 7-inch touchscreen running the Uconnect infotainment system, which could be upgraded to an 8.4-inch screen. While initially complex, the system offered useful features such as Jeep’s off-road pages and compatibility with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. The Wrangler stayed true to its roots by avoiding excessive tech features, focusing on practicality.

In contrast, the 2024 Lexus GX featured a 14-inch touchscreen integrated with the Lexus Interface infotainment system. It supported Wireless Apple CarPlay, Wireless Android Auto, and an intelligent voice assistant through the Drive Connect subscription service. Additional connectivity included multiple USB-C ports and, in some models, a 21-speaker Mark Levinson stereo. The focus on luxury and convenience was evident, although some features were subscription-based after a free trial period.

Safety

2023 Jeep Wrangler

6/10

2024 Lexus GX

8/10

Safety was not the 2023 Jeep Wrangler’s strong suit. Standard features included a rearview camera, electronic roll mitigation, and stability control. Advanced features like blind-spot monitoring and forward collision warning were standard only on the top 392 model or available as options. The Wrangler earned mixed safety ratings from the IIHS and NHTSA, highlighting areas in need of improvement.

The 2024 Lexus GX made significant safety advancements with the Lexus Safety System+ 3.0, which included pre-collision detection, adaptive cruise control with stop-and-go, lane-tracing assist, and road-sign recognition. The GA-F architecture added to the vehicle's structural integrity, although official safety ratings were not yet available at the time of review.

CarGurus highlights

Winning Vehicle Image

According to CarGurus experts, the overall rating for the 2023 Jeep Wrangler was 7.8 out of 10, while the 2024 Lexus GX scored 7.7 out of 10. Although both vehicles have their merits, the 2023 Jeep Wrangler surpasses the 2024 Lexus GX in terms of overall rating. If you prioritize off-road performance and rugged design, the Jeep Wrangler is the better option. However, if luxury, advanced safety, and technology are at the top of your list, the Lexus GX is a compelling choice. Ultimately, the 2023 Jeep Wrangler earns our recommendation as the superior overall vehicle based on CarGurus ratings.
